83 300CD Cold Idling Oddity
On my 83 300CD (246,000), the car always started up perfectly (even in 15F weather), but it always has had a "miss" or "flutter" when idling cold. I exhanged the injectors, but no improvement. I have also checked for air leaks. ODDLY, this morning, I put the car in drive and the idle was perfect. I put in back in park & the miss/flutter returns. Likewise, in drive, there is no fluttering. What could be causing this? In driving MB diesels for 30 years, I have never experienced this, nor heard anyone mention this. Thanks!

What is your idle speed in Drive?
It could not hurt to try an adjustment of the Rack Dampner Screw. Valve adjustment? A couple of Members have said that stretching the Spring in their Fuel Injection Pump Pressure Relief/Overflow Valve to the limit that the Manual allows helped. http://www.peachparts.com/shopforum/showthread.php?t=234609 Mine idles better in Park than in Drive also but I do not feel that it is actually rough.
